Marguerite RICHARD was born 1 May 1720 in Port Royal, Acadia

Marguerite RICHARD was the child of Alexandre RICHARD   and   Marie LEVRON and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Michel RICHARD dit SANSOUCY and Jeanne BABIN (maternal)  François LEVRON dit NANTAIS and Catherine SAVOIE

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Marguerite  married  Jean BREAU (BRAULT) 25 October 1745 in Port Royal, Acadia .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Jean BREAU (BRAULT)  was born abt. 1706 in Grand Pré, Nova Scotia, Canada (Saint-Charles-des-Mines, Acadia).  Jean died abt. 1756 in .  Jean was the child of François BREAU (BRAULT) and Marie COMEAU.

Marguerite RICHARD died 8 December 1757 in Québec, Canada, New France .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
